Eight-times world billiards champion Advani disposed of 2005 world champion Shaun Murphy in the first round and wasted little time in dispensing with the man who won the Crucible title the following year. Breaks of 63 and 73 in the first two frames put him in control before Dott pulled one back with an 84. However a 75 run in the following frame put him within one of victory - and he compiled a break of 100 dead to seal a sensational win. He will face the winner of the match between world number one Judd Trump and Andrew Higginson in the last eight. Results Round two Ken Doherty 4 - 3 Tom Ford Pankaj Advani 4 - 1 Graeme Dott
